Harper experiences a semi-arid climate with hot summers and cold winters, which can lead to frozen pipes in winter and heavy runoff in summer. These conditions contribute to the risk of sewage backups and water damage in residential and commercial properties.

Blackwater exposure in Harper poses serious health risks, including bacterial infections and respiratory issues. Prompt cleanup is essential to prevent long-term health complications and ensure the safety of residents and workers.
